Choosing the Perfect Under-Seat Carry-On Bag
Now that we've established why under-seat bags are the cat's pajamas, let's talk about how to pick the right one for you.
Size Matters
First things first, check the dimensions of the bag against the airline's carry-on policy. Most airlines accept bags that are 16" x 13" x 9" or smaller, but it's always a good idea to double-check.
Materials and Durability
You want a bag that's going to stand up to some serious wear and tear. Look for durable materials like ballistic nylon or polyester, and make sure the zippers are sturdy and secure.
Compartments and Pockets
The beauty of an under-seat bag is its ability to keep you organized. Look for bags with plenty of compartments and pockets to keep your stuff separate and easy to find.
Comfort and Carrying Options
You're going to be carrying this bag around a lot, so comfort is key. Look for bags with padded shoulder straps or handles, and consider whether you prefer a backpack or a shoulder bag.

Packing Like a Pro: Maximizing Your Under-Seat Bag Space
Now that you've got your dream bag, let's talk about how to pack it like a pro.
Roll, Don't Fold
Rolling your clothes instead of folding them can save you serious space and help prevent wrinkles.
Use Packing Cubes
Packing cubes can help you stay organized and maximize your space. They're a game-changer, trust us.
Wear Your Bulkiest Clothes
If you've got a big coat or heavy boots, wear them on the plane. It'll save you space and keep you cozy on the flight.
